1. Location: Shoshone, Idaho - is named after the Shoshone Native American tribe, but is pronounced "show-shown", with the e silent.
2. About: The cave can create a living glacier in a lava desert. Its ice block is about 1,000 feet long and varies from 8 to 30 feet in depth. No matter how hot it is outside, the temperature drops as soon as you enter the cave.
